Not sure why 1 star is the lowest rating we can give. So here’s one star that this place absolutely does not deserve.

We stopped by for coffee & a snack with my husband and young son. We wanted something sweet, so we ordered French toast. It came out one (end piece) of French toast, and something else that was like a pancake? When I pointed it out to the server that this not only wasn’t a piece of French toast, it wasnt even cooked throughout and was raw in the middle. A man (the owner) sitting at the only other table in the restaurant, overheard and pointed out that they’ve been “so busy” the last few days that they ran out of bread. Okay, well then, you should let us know that you’re out of this item. Not try to serve something completely different. How deceitful.

The server herself was extremely friendly. And suggested the waffles, that were fine, my 18 month old son enjoyed them.

When we went to pay, each item on the receipt was $1 more than on the menu! Cappuccino on the menu $3, fruit juices on the menu, $3. And once the bill came, they were $4 each… again- how deceitful. The owner was now gone and it was just the server trying to figure out why this was (after I pointed it out). The server kindly suggested removing the service fee to make the bill lower, I told it was fine and since we were staying down the road we would most likely be back and will speak to the owner then.

I came back with my son the next day to have waffles for breakfast. The owner was there, and I told him about the discrepancy between his menu prices and the bill. And his response? “We just started serving breakfast about a week ago, so there’s a few things to iron out”. I was shocked. This was his customer service. On an already returning customer!!

I will never ever come back here. And I urge you not to either. Someone who runs an establishment with such deceit, and unapologetically, is definitely not worthy of your money. I normally only leave good reviews as I like to boost the exceptional experiences that we have. Im also a give believer in customer service, anything that goes wrong, can definitely be fixed in the way the management handles the situation. Unfortunately this place is more than worthy of this review.

A tip to the owner- if you have a discrepancy on the bill vs the menu that YOU have made. Then the difference should be on you. Suck up the $3 and leave your customer happy. Can’t afford to give back the $3? Then offer the customer a free coffee, which would cost you 10 cents. And show that you actually care to keep...

Absolutely the worst experience I have had in a year of living in Costa Rica. My fiancé and I came here for our anniversary for dinner.. Within the first 5 minutes after ordering, someone near us starting smoking a cigarette in the restaurant. The entire time we were there trying to eat our food someone was smoking a cigarette, at one point there were 5 people smoking cigarettes at the same time. At this point I went to the manager and spoke to him, he said he would ask everyone to stop, which he didn’t. Our whole dinner was ruined. When we went to pay the manager didn’t try to do anything, or do some small gesture to apologize, he didn’t even address it really, it was awkward. So we paid then I said that our night was ruined and he said that’s it poker night and this only happens on poker night (letting people smoke cigarettes in the restaurant). So I told him that he should inform the customers that they are allowing people to smoke inside the restaurant so they can choose if they want to eat there or not. And then he told me he can’t because they are just trying to survive the rainy season. This is not a tico owned restaurant (owned by a local), this is a foreign owned restaurant. If you have enough money to have a Foreign investment, then I think you can afford to be honest to your customers. The least he could have done was offer to not have to pay the bill, or taken something off of it. I told him this and he said they could afford it. I have lived in Costa Rica for about a year and have been to many restaurants, I have never experience people smoking in the restaurant. Also the food was bland. And they didn’t even bring us water. All in all, don’t waste your time,...

Stopped in twice during our trip to the Westin Playa Conchal last week. Met the Proprietor of the pub, Jake. Super friendly guy that enjoys visiting with his customers about BBQ, Florida, Surfing, Good Beer, his cat and the awesome country of Costa Rica! We had the Hefeweizen and the Amber. The aluminum supply chain shortage forced the Amber to be canned in a Stout can but that just adds to the Pura Vida experience. Both the beers were top notch and rival anything I’ve had in the states. Unfortunately we didn’t get to check out the BBQ but since I’m a BBQ guy (gotta few championship banners of my own) I can tell that Jake knows what he’s doing and the BBQ would be fantastic. This place is a hidden gem that will blow up some day as it is right in the middle of a great run of restaurants in Brasilito (Cameron Dorado, Patagonia Del Mar, Papaya, Soda Brasilito) and directly across from the beach. Loved Los Olas...

Missing REALLY GOOD smoked ribs? Look no further than Las Olas Brewing in Brasilito! On weekends, the restaurant offers smoked ribs with a free beer. The ribs were smoked with a perfect oaky flavor. The savory bbq sauce added extra flavor on the outside of the ribs with fall apart tender meat on the inside. We’ve been searching for smoked ribs and these are what dreams are made of. Their sides are also worth another visit. The fries were hand cut and the coleslaw was equal parts creamy and crunchy deliciousness leaving you wanting more…thanks, Jake! (Bonus, Jake the owner is super nice).
